How to Plan a Family Picnic

A family picnic is an excellent way to enjoy the outdoors and spend some quality time with the people you love. There are numerous activities you could do as a family when having an outdoor picnic. Instructions

    • 1

      Decide how many people you want to have at your family picnic. A family picnic can consist of just immediate family members. You could also turn it into a large family outing. Consider this before planning anything else.

    • 2

      Find the perfect place to hold your family picnic. How many people you decide to invite to your family picnic will be a determining factor when finding where to have the picnic. You could have your family picnic anywhere from a local park to your backyard.

    • 3

      Make sure that you have plenty of coolers. People often underestimate how little a cooler can hold once ice or ice packs have been placed into the cooler. Chances are that one cooler will not be enough for your family picnic.

    • 4

      Remember that healthy snacks are the easiest snacks. Picnics are often seen as an opportunity to eat a ton of food, most of which isn't necessarily good for you. Apples, bananas and grapes are easy to pack and dispose of, not to mention nutritious and filling.

    • 5

      Plan plenty of outdoor activities for your family picnic. A picnic isn't just about food, after all. Something as simple as a volleyball net can make for a very entertaining family picnic. If you're not in the mood for sports, have your outdoor picnic near a hiking trail. A family picnic should be about enjoying the outdoors with those you love.

    • 6

      Check the weather before you head out for your family picnic. A lot of planning does go into a family picnic but it's still important to know how the weather conditions before you leave your house. It may be annoying but it would be better to reschedule your family picnic than to have it ruined by rain.
